Witam wszystkich,
Jako , ze powoli zbliza sie wiosna odswiezam wczesniej nie dokonczone projekty a jednym z nich jest wlasnie sterowanie bojlerem. Problemem w moim wypadku nie jest opracowanie komunikacji z poziomu aplikacji ale z poziomu sprzetowego - czyli stworzenie dobrego projektu plytki.
Zalozenia komunikacji ktore musze wziac pod uwage
+ Napiecie na lini bez kontrolera i innych urzadzen to ~24V AC ( za mostkiem uzywanym w kontrolerze to okolo 23.3V DC )
+ Bojler komunikuje sie zmieniajac prad z
5-9mA (0) na
17-23mA (1) + Kontroler komunikuje sie zmieniajac napiecie z
5-7V ( 0 ) na
15-17V (1)+ Kontroler powinen domyslnie utrzymywac na lini stan niski
I to w zasadzie sa calkowite wymagaia z poziomu sprzetowego no i tutaj pojawia sie moja prosba czy bardziej obeznani w temacie elektroniki sprzetowej mogli by poradzic w zakresie projektu plytki ?
Do zmiany napiecia na lini pomyslalem , ze cos takiego moglo by miec sens :
Pomysl opiera sie na tym ze mam 2 diody zenera - jedna , ktora zmienia mi napiecie na ~15V a druga na ~5 tutaj zakladajac , ze sterujac z uC bede utrzymywac stan wysoki aby na lini panowalo "0" czyli bylo napiecie ~5V
Natomiast jesli chodzi o wykrywanie zmiany pradu - to nie mam na chwile obecna pomyslu jaki mozna by tutaj dolozyc zeby mialo to rece i nogi :/
Z gory dzieki za pomoc
Raf